But now we are back…….. last blog was about the Bin Flag and at the end we mentioned a way to connect it to a phone alarm dialer.
When you pair the Bin Flag with an alarm phone dialer you will receive a phone alarm whenever feed levels drop below the critical level. Setting the Bin Flag up with most alarm systems is a pretty simple process. Purchase the magnetic sensor for less than $20 (item #HDL59065-952) and screw it into the Bin Flag. You then run common phone wire from the sensor to a contact on the phone dialer. The alarm system will allow you to program a unique message that identifies each particular bin.
Really I’m not so sure this isn’t a more important feature than the visual part of the Bin Flag…… normally you have to be at the building site and look at the Bin Flag. But with the Bin Flag connected to an alarm it calls you. So whether you are in the field, on the road, wherever you have cell service you will be notified when a feed outage occurs and have to time to react and get feed ordered.
